Js tömbök módszerekkel dolgozó tömbök, web-fejlesztők blog

Js tömbök módszerekkel dolgozó tömbök, web-fejlesztők blog

Kihívások ilyen módszerek elő az alábbiak szerint.

imyaMassiva.imyaMetoda (argumen1, argumen2 ... argumentN);

A js sok beépített módszert kínál tömböket is támogatja most élő böngészők. Kéri, hogy ezek a módszerek inkább módosítja a tömböt.







Ez eltávolítja az utolsó elem a tömbben és visszaadja a törölt elem.

var arr = [1, 2, 3, 4]; console.log (arr.pop ()); // 4 console.log (arr); // [1, 2, 3]. testsúly változás

Hozzáfűzi egy tetszőleges a tömb elemeinek számát, amelyet kap paraméterként. Ez a módszer hosszát adja vissza az új, kibővült tömb.







függvény sortFunct (a, b)

Van is több módszer, amely nem támogatja a régebbi böngészők, de a legújabb verzió az Opera, a króm, mozzily és még IE9 nem lehet gond. Ha szüksége van egy cross-böngésző kompatibilitás, akkor használja a jQuery, ahol ezeket a módszereket már ott van.

Ez a módszer kiválasztja elemeit a tömb szerint egy bizonyos szempont, és visszaadja azt tömbként. A paraméter kap funkciót. Ez a függvény paraméterként egy olyan elemre, amely megbecsüli egyes indokok, és vissza igaz. ha az elem megfelel ennek a kritériumnak, és egyébként false. Például akkor válassza ki az összes, még egy tömb elemeit.

Ez fogadja a paraméterként funkciót. Ez a függvény paraméterként egy olyan funkciót fogják hívni minden tömb elem. Származhat használja ezt a funkciót egy sor elemek egy oszlopban a konzolon.

var arr = [ 'egy', 'két', 'három', 'négy', 'öt']; arr.forEach (function (db) );

Ez igaz értékkel tér vissza. ha minden elemét a tömb megfelel egy bizonyos állapotban, és hamis egyébként. Ellenőrizze, hogy az összes elemet a tömb páros.




Kapcsolódó cikkek